What are the responsibilities and job description for the Pruner position at Disneyland Resort?
Local, Southern California applicants sought - No relocation offered.
A Pruner at the Disneyland Resort provides day-to-day tree care for the Resort's urban forest under the direction of an Arboricultural Manager. This role involves maintaining trees and Resort aesthetics in accordance with the theme of the specific area while ensuring Guest and Cast Member comfort and safety.
Key Responsibilities:
- Maintain trees and Resort aesthetics to meet theme standards
- Ensure Guest and Cast Member comfort and safety
Basic Qualifications:
- Available to work any shift (1st, 2nd, 3rd) including holidays with variable days off
- Experience performing tree pruning, inspection, and climbing tasks
- Valid California Driver's License
- Western Chapter Certified Tree Worker (WC-CTW) certification or equivalent ability
- At least 18 years old
Schedule Availability:
The Disneyland Resort operates 24/7, 365 days a year. Shifts may start as early as 2:00 AM or end as late as 10:30 AM. This is a full-time role requiring full availability, including evenings, weekends, and holidays when needed.

The pay rate for this role in California is $29.12 to $35.47 per hour, following the Collective Bargaining Agreement pay scale. The base pay offered may vary based on geographic region, job-related knowledge, skills, and experience. Select benefits may be provided as part of the compensation package.
